Bloodshot Records Celebrates 25th Anniversary
Chicago-based Bloodshot Records is celebrating its 25th anniversary. The label has historically focused exclusively on blues, traditional rock-n-roll, and country-rock music. It began 25 years ago with a charity album aimed at supporting Chicago blues clubs.
